Output dd3a879a73954d99e9f74ac92ea1bba7da3dd1eb442b1eeb37618014bc1539be:1

value
370686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deeaea60b39e29f45bd989c2ee853a01c2290e89 OP_EQUAL
address
3N1hMM8P6b87jSnDnC1iysQUdwc9kKezXn
transaction
dd3a879a73954d99e9f74ac92ea1bba7da3dd1eb442b1eeb37618014bc1539be
spent
true